Step 1
Puree the onion in a food processor. Sieve its juice into a large mixing bowl. We just need the juice.
Step 2
Put the ground beef, döner kebab seasoning, salt, yogurt and milk in the same bowl. Combine them well using your hand. Give it a log shape.
Step 3
Transfer it on a baking paper and wrap it tightly.
Step 4
Let it rest in the fridge for 2 hours. Then transfer it to the freezer and let it sit there for 8 hours or overnight.
Step 5
Remove it from the freezer and let it sit on the counter for 5 minutes. Hold the döner log with a piece of baking paper and carefully make large thin slices using a sharp knife.
Step 6
Heat one teaspoon butter in a non stick pan over high heat. Line sliced döner pieces in a single layer and cook both sides until nicely brown.
Step 7
Cook döner in batches and never overload the pan.
